【實戰教學】打造你的 24 小時自動化獲利機器:Hummingbot 造市策略與 GCP 雲端部屬全攻略


在加密貨幣市場中,除了追高殺跌的「方向性交易」,有沒有更穩定的獲利方式?答案是有的,那就是**「造市策略 (Market Making)」**。今天我將帶你深入了解開源量化交易神器 —— Hummingbot,並手把手教你如何將它部屬在 Google 雲端(GCP),實現全天候自動化套利。
一、 什麼是造市策略?為何選它?
造市(Market Making)並非預測幣價漲跌,其核心目標是**「高頻小額、穩定套利」** 。
運作原理:同時在市場掛出「買單 (Bid)」與「賣單 (Ask)」。當有人吃掉你的賣單,機器人立即補單,透過賺取買賣價差 (Bid-Ask Spread) 與交易所返佣來累積收益 。
優勢:穩定收益且風險相對可控,能結合交易所的流動性挖礦活動獲取額外獎勵 。
二、 Hummingbot:量化交易者的瑞士刀
Hummingbot 是一個免費且開源的 Python 量化交易框架 。
多平台支援:可連接 Binance、OKX、KuCoin 等主流交易所及 DEX 。
策略多樣:內建經典造市 (Pure Market Making)、跨交易所套利 (Cross Exchange MM) 及現貨-期貨對沖 (Spot-Perpetual Arbitrage) 等範本 。
三、 實戰指南:在 GCP 雲端部屬機器人
為了讓機器人穩定運行,使用雲端伺服器(VPS)是必要的 。以下是使用 Google Cloud Platform (GCP) 的部屬步驟:
1. 建立 VM 虛擬機 (省錢配置建議)
路徑:Compute Engine → VM instances → Create Instance 。
機器類型:選擇 e2-micro (對於執行單一機器人已足夠且便宜) 。
區域:推薦選擇 us-west1 或 us-central1 。
磁碟與防火牆:設定 20GB 標準永久磁碟,並允許 HTTP/HTTPS 流量 。
2. 環境安裝 (一鍵指令)
登入 SSH 後,建議使用 Docker 運行以避免環境衝突:
安裝 Docker 與 Git:使用一鍵安裝腳本快速完成環境設置 。
克隆代碼:從 GitHub 取得 Hummingbot 源碼並啟動 。
四、 如何提高勝率?AI 加持的開發流程
對於技術新手,可以善用 AI 工具來優化策略:
DeepWiki 技術查詢:針對 Hummingbot 的代碼架構或 API 整合,透過 DeepWiki 能得到精準且低幻覺的技術解答 。
Gemini CLI 輔助:在 VM 內運行 AI 助手,直接協助分析、修改或執行策略代碼 。
五、 核心風險與獲利模型
能賺錢嗎? 這取決於你的收入是否大於支出 :
收益來源:手續費返佣 + 造市利潤 + 交易量空投獎勵 。
潛在風險:
單邊行情風險:價格劇烈波動可能導致單邊持倉過重 。
對沖成本:若使用對沖模式 (Hedge),需注意保證金管理,避免槓桿過大導致爆倉 。
結語:行動是第一步
量化交易不再是金融大鱷的專利。透過 Hummingbot 與 GCP,你也能低門檻開啟自己的自動化交易之路。如果你想獲取更深度的參數調教心得或一鍵部署腳本,歡迎訂閱我的專欄!
本文內容基於實戰經驗分享,投資加密貨幣具風險,請謹慎評估自身承擔能力。
想加入群組或有疑問私訊IG:goodtime0529
















